There’s something wonderfully nostalgic about banana bread. For me, it began on a rainy afternoon with a bunch of overly ripe bananas and a craving for something warm and homey. I didn’t want to waste those spotty bananas sitting on the counter—too soft for snacking, but just perfect for baking.

This banana bread recipe is the kind you come back to again and again. It’s rich, moist, perfectly sweetened, and infused with deep banana flavor. Whether you’re baking for breakfast, a lunchbox treat, or an afternoon coffee companion, this loaf delivers comfort with every bite.

If you’ve been searching for that just-right banana bread—golden on the outside, soft and buttery on the inside—keep reading. This recipe might become your new go-to.

Why I Love This Recipe

Banana bread is one of those timeless recipes that never go out of style. It’s practical, frugal, and deeply satisfying. What I love most about this version is its perfect balance: sweet but not cloying, rich but not too heavy, moist without being soggy.

The magic lies in the simplicity. You don’t need a mixer, you don’t need fancy ingredients—just a bowl, a fork, and a little patience while your house fills with the smell of baked bananas and warm vanilla.

The specialty of this banana bread is in its texture. It’s soft and tender, yet it holds its shape beautifully when sliced. A little bit of brown sugar adds a caramel undertone, while sour cream (or Greek yogurt) keeps it from drying out. I’ve tested many variations over the years, and this one stands out for its reliability, richness, and flavor depth.

And the best part? It’s customizable. Add nuts for crunch, chocolate chips for indulgence, or leave it plain for classic comfort. It’s also a great recipe to teach kids or beginner bakers because it’s so forgiving. This is banana bread as it’s meant to be—effortless, cozy, and universally loved.

Ingredients for Banana Bread

To make the perfect banana bread, you’ll want to start with the right ingredients. Here’s what you need and why:

Overripe bananas: These are the star of the show. Look for bananas with brown spots or a completely brown peel. The riper they are, the more moisture and natural sweetness they’ll contribute to the bread.

All-purpose flour: Gives the bread its structure. You can also experiment with a mix of whole wheat flour for added fiber, but too much can make the loaf dense.

Baking soda: This reacts with the acidity in the bananas and sour cream to create lift and keep the bread soft and fluffy.

Salt: Just a pinch balances out the sweetness and brings out all the flavors.

Unsalted butter: Adds richness and depth. Melted butter makes the mixing process easier and gives the bread a slightly denser, cake-like crumb.

Brown sugar and granulated sugar: A mix of both adds moisture and complexity. The brown sugar brings a hint of molasses which pairs beautifully with banana.

Eggs: Bind the ingredients and help the bread rise.

Vanilla extract: Adds warmth and enhances the banana flavor.

Sour cream or Greek yogurt: This is what makes the loaf incredibly moist without being greasy. It also gives the crumb a tender texture.

Optional mix-ins: Chopped walnuts, pecans, or chocolate chips. You can add about ¾ cup of your favorite mix-ins to customize the loaf.

All these ingredients work in harmony to deliver that rich, comforting flavor and texture we associate with the best homemade banana bread.

How Much Time Will You Need?

Making banana bread doesn’t require a full afternoon in the kitchen. Here’s how the time breaks down:

  • Prep time: 15 minutes
  • Baking time: 55 to 65 minutes
  • Cooling time: At least 20 minutes before slicing

So in just under 90 minutes (with only about 15 minutes of hands-on work), you’ll have a warm loaf of banana bread ready to serve.

How to Make This Banana Bread

This banana bread comes together in a single bowl and follows a simple sequence of mixing, pouring, and baking. Here’s how to make it step by step:

Step 1: Preheat the oven
Preheat your oven to 350°F (175°C). Grease a 9×5-inch loaf pan with butter or nonstick spray. You can also line it with parchment paper for easier removal.

Step 2: Mash the bananas
In a large mixing bowl, mash 3 large overripe bananas with a fork until mostly smooth. It’s fine if a few small lumps remain—this adds texture to the bread.

Step 3: Mix in the wet ingredients
Add ½ cup melted unsalted butter, ¾ cup brown sugar, and ¼ cup granulated sugar. Stir until smooth. Then mix in 2 large eggs, one at a time. Add 1 teaspoon vanilla extract and ½ cup sour cream (or Greek yogurt). Stir until everything is well combined.

Step 4: Combine the dry ingredients
In a separate bowl, whisk together 1¾ cups all-purpose flour, 1 teaspoon baking soda, and ½ teaspoon salt. Slowly add the dry ingredients to the wet banana mixture and gently stir with a spatula or wooden spoon until just combined. Do not overmix.

Step 5: Add optional mix-ins
If you’re using nuts or chocolate chips, fold them in now. About ¾ cup of chopped walnuts or semisweet chocolate chips work great.

Step 6: Pour into the pan
Pour the batter into the prepared loaf pan and smooth the top with a spatula. For a decorative touch, you can slice an extra banana lengthwise and lay it on top.

Step 7: Bake
Place the pan in the center of the preheated oven. Bake for 55–65 minutes, or until a toothpick inserted into the center comes out mostly clean (a few moist crumbs are okay, but no wet batter).

Step 8: Cool and slice
Let the banana bread cool in the pan for 10–15 minutes. Then carefully remove it from the pan and transfer it to a wire rack to cool for at least 20 minutes before slicing.

The loaf should be golden brown, slightly domed, and deeply fragrant—ready to enjoy.

Substitutions

Banana bread is wonderfully flexible. Here are some tested substitutions you can make:

Butter: Swap for an equal amount of coconut oil or vegetable oil for a dairy-free version. Coconut oil will add a subtle tropical note.

Sour cream: Use plain Greek yogurt or buttermilk. Both work well to add moisture and tang.

Sugar: You can use all brown sugar for a deeper molasses flavor or coconut sugar for a more natural option. For a lower glycemic alternative, monk fruit sweetener or erythritol blends can also work, though the texture may vary.

Flour: Whole wheat flour can replace up to half of the all-purpose flour without significantly affecting texture. For gluten-free banana bread, use a 1:1 gluten-free flour blend with xanthan gum included.

Eggs: To make it egg-free, use ¼ cup unsweetened applesauce or 1 tablespoon flaxseed meal mixed with 3 tablespoons water (per egg).

Bananas: If you’re short on bananas, mashed cooked sweet potato or pumpkin puree can be used for part of the fruit, but keep at least 2 bananas for the signature flavor.

These substitutions help adapt the recipe for dietary needs or pantry limitations while keeping the integrity of the banana bread intact.

Best Side Dishes for Banana Bread

Banana bread is satisfying on its own, but if you’re serving it as part of a brunch or afternoon snack, here are a few complementary side ideas:

1. Honey Yogurt Parfait
Layer Greek yogurt with honey and fresh berries for a light and creamy side that balances the sweetness of the bread.

2. Soft Scrambled Eggs
If you’re making a full breakfast, a side of fluffy scrambled eggs adds protein and makes it a complete meal.

3. Fresh Fruit Salad
A mix of sliced citrus, apples, and grapes brightens up the plate and adds a refreshing contrast to the dense, sweet banana loaf.

Serving and Presentation Tips

Banana bread might be a humble bake, but how you serve it can make all the difference. Whether you’re enjoying it at home or offering it to guests, a thoughtful presentation enhances the experience.

Slice with intention—Use a serrated knife to cut even, thick slices. Banana bread is soft, and a clean cut preserves the crumb and shape.

Serve warm or toasted—Banana bread tastes incredible slightly warmed. Toast a slice lightly and add a thin pat of butter that melts into the loaf, or serve it cold for a firmer bite.

Pair with accompaniments—For a brunch platter, present slices alongside ramekins of softened butter, cream cheese, or a honey drizzle. You can also serve it with a dollop of mascarpone and a sprinkle of chopped nuts for an elevated touch.

Add a garnish—A light dusting of powdered sugar, a drizzle of chocolate ganache, or a few banana slices can enhance its visual appeal without overpowering the flavor.

Use wooden boards or linen-lined trays—Rustic serving platters highlight the homemade charm of banana bread. Add fresh herbs or edible flowers for a photo-ready finish.

Tips and Tricks to Make This Recipe Better

Here’s how to take your banana bread from good to unforgettable:

  • Use extra-ripe bananas: The darker, the better. When the peel turns almost black, that’s when bananas are the sweetest and most flavorful.
  • Don’t overmix the batter: Stir just until the dry ingredients are incorporated. Overmixing leads to a tough, dense loaf.
  • Room temperature ingredients: Especially for eggs and sour cream. They mix better, helping to create a uniform batter.
  • Let it rest: Once baked, let your banana bread cool at least 20 minutes before slicing. This allows the crumb to set, so the slices hold together.
  • Toast the nuts before adding: If using walnuts or pecans, a quick toast brings out their flavor and prevents sogginess inside the loaf.
  • Freeze for later: Banana bread freezes beautifully. Wrap individual slices in parchment and store in a zip-top bag to pull out as needed.
  • Split the batter: For quicker baking and perfect gifting, divide the batter into mini loaf pans or muffin tins and adjust the baking time accordingly.

Common Mistakes to Avoid

Even a simple recipe like banana bread can go wrong if you’re not careful. Here are the most common mistakes—and how to avoid them:

Using underripe bananas: They lack the sweetness and moisture that make banana bread special. Only use ripe or overripe bananas.

Overmixing the batter: This is one of the easiest ways to ruin the texture. Stir just until combined.

Not greasing the pan properly: Banana bread has a tendency to stick. Use butter, nonstick spray, or parchment paper to prevent tears when unmolding.

Opening the oven too soon: This can deflate the loaf. Avoid opening the oven during the first 45 minutes of baking.

Skipping the cooling time: If you cut the bread too early, it’ll crumble and fall apart. Be patient—it’s worth it.

Inaccurate measuring: Use a kitchen scale or level off your flour with a knife. Too much flour leads to a dry loaf.

How to Store It

Banana bread stores well at room temperature, in the fridge, or in the freezer. Here’s how to keep it fresh:

At room temperature:
Wrap the cooled loaf tightly in plastic wrap or foil and store in an airtight container. It stays moist for up to 4 days.

In the refrigerator:
If your kitchen is warm or humid, refrigerate it to prevent spoilage. Wrap it well to prevent it from drying out. It keeps up to 7 days.

Freezing banana bread:
Wrap individual slices or the entire loaf in plastic wrap, then place in a freezer-safe zip-top bag. It will last for 2–3 months. To thaw, leave at room temperature or microwave individual slices for 30–45 seconds.

Pro tip: Label your freezer bag with the date, so you remember when it was stored.

FAQ

1. Can I make banana bread without eggs?
Yes, use ¼ cup unsweetened applesauce or 1 tablespoon flaxseed meal mixed with 3 tablespoons water per egg.

2. Can I use frozen bananas?
Absolutely. Let them thaw completely and drain any excess liquid before mashing.

3. How can I make banana bread more moist?
Use sour cream or Greek yogurt and don’t overbake. Also, don’t skimp on the ripe bananas—they add essential moisture.

4. Can I add chocolate chips or nuts?
Yes! Add about ¾ cup of chocolate chips or chopped nuts. Fold them in gently after mixing the batter.

5. Why did my banana bread sink in the middle?
This usually happens if the loaf is underbaked or the oven temperature is too low. Always check with a toothpick and bake until it’s clean or has just a few moist crumbs.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Banana Bread Recipe


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Olivia Rodrigo
  • Total Time: 1 hour 15 minutes
  • Yield: 1 loaf (8–10 slices)
  • Diet: Vegetarian

Description

This banana bread recipe is your go-to classic—moist, rich, and full of comforting banana flavor. It’s made in one bowl, needs no mixer, and bakes up beautifully golden with a tender crumb. Whether you enjoy it for breakfast, snack time, or dessert, this banana bread delivers big flavor and cozy nostalgia in every slice. Customizable with nuts or chocolate, and easy to store or freeze, it’s a must-have recipe for any home baker.


Ingredients

  • 3 overripe bananas, mashed
  • ½ cup unsalted butter, melted
  • ¾ cup brown sugar
  • ¼ cup granulated sugar
  • 2 large eggs
  • 1 teaspoon vanilla extract
  • ½ cup sour cream or Greek yogurt
  • 1¾ cups all-purpose flour
  • 1 teaspoon baking soda
  • ½ teaspoon salt
  • Optional: ¾ cup chopped walnuts or chocolate chips


Instructions

  • Preheat oven to 350°F (175°C). Grease or line a 9×5-inch loaf pan.
  • In a large bowl, mash bananas until mostly smooth.
  • Stir in melted butter, brown sugar, and granulated sugar until well combined.
  • Mix in eggs one at a time, then add vanilla and sour cream. Stir until smooth.
  • In a separate bowl, whisk flour, baking soda, and salt.
  • Gently fold dry ingredients into wet ingredients until just combined.
  • Stir in nuts or chocolate chips, if using.
  • Pour batter into prepared pan and smooth the top.
  • Bake 55–65 minutes, or until a toothpick comes out clean.
  • Let cool 15 minutes in pan, then transfer to a wire rack to cool completely.

Notes

Use very ripe bananas with brown peels for best flavor.

Don’t overmix the batter—stir until just combined.

For extra flavor, toast the nuts before adding.

  • Prep Time: 15 minutes
  • Cook Time: 60 minutes
  • Category: Baked Goods
  • Method: Baking
  • Cuisine: American

Nutrition

  • Serving Size: 1 slice
  • Calories: 260

More Recipes

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star